From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mga12.intel.com (mga12.intel.com [192.55.52.136]) by sourceware.org (Postfix) with ESMTPS id 5BF8D384A033 for ; Mon, 15 Jun 2020 08:54:51 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.3.2 sourceware.org 5BF8D384A033 IronPort-SDR: AjkupG+XyM2Z+tMbnzRXcu337SRxsHDDuPcXnpS+ZM1dO9g9TWGwo6b1MWLxdn0c9gTNTBA/gw gNX1GNFSqN3A== X-Amp-Result: SKIPPED(no attachment in message) X-Amp-File-Uploaded: False Received: from fmsmga008.fm.intel.com ([10.253.24.58]) by fmsmga106.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 15 Jun 2020 01:54:50 -0700 IronPort-SDR: T4+bhuFTNXcICa6pOe8w+hSuuY6dwLkta6hlYp6vsm0Bw75PiaTWQsvuOqoltj3qv4Y2JTaO2C 0M96+wo5pwWA== X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="5.73,514,1583222400"; d="scan'208";a="262676223" Received: from orsmsx105.amr.corp.intel.com ([10.22.225.132]) by fmsmga008.fm.intel.com with ESMTP; 15 Jun 2020 01:54:49 -0700 Received: from orsmsx152.amr.corp.intel.com (10.22.226.39) by ORSMSX105.amr.corp.intel.com (10.22.225.132) with Microsoft SMTP Server (TLS) id 14.3.439.0; Mon, 15 Jun 2020 01:54:49 -0700 Received: from ORSEDG002.ED.cps.intel.com (10.7.248.5) by ORSMSX152.amr.corp.intel.com (10.22.226.39) with Microsoft SMTP Server (TLS) id 14.3.439.0; Mon, 15 Jun 2020 01:54:49 -0700 Received: from NAM11-DM6-obe.outbound.protection.outlook.com (104.47.57.174) by edgegateway.intel.com (134.134.137.101) with Microsoft SMTP Server (TLS) id 14.3.439.0; Mon, 15 Jun 2020 01:54:48 -0700 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=DGEVU25kPJ4VQJqqMCKaSr8yEzrQZpHlgWeFAvZWM5CVb6E3TMpSqofCB2KsHSZ+Y21d0+jwdfMFf3PZH/BnH8v5dqs81cin9kM/aBP1gBOVdop0A+YJw7YFLhEHQvaOLMwq10C+dDyF6FeOD/tA67ms+eV02YVo+1+tyYHo6oHFDRjxMhuh6oxGqb0fZJEGuPcJqEiVflTR29+1xQGGufMQwhrdRBOj41H+abPAAMN8Hoo465bvdDL2nRzyN4pu95M0TRTQUMu/0yEA14ZVY91TSrv4EPRwUEFjOIYVUNZmyZUTyzDZJ14sXvqQk0ImjcLsRsaPE+s2W7LK0XwscQ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-SenderADCheck; bh=3vt7O02yFTRR5EffsrzOfZ3qVVdSpnDdm+AB3PqCzmQ=; b=H4PoFG0Cx7efeCQB7swKjFMZGJVzBGlrqfMhwbCVmMBxyIdy/tzvSZlvAP8vJ2KgHNh+aunTrGiJkmmBHJTv0jiYLgo0BOOetdMfmRJIlsxuVxejWnFmdFhx90ci7c5UwAmgLc/w1LZntqvwKgIzTVNYLRguxfZIVNKq+O+ADySGoQ6GD0NL9//JOQs9lFff8AcDZZbS8hIGkwHFsbMApHkTg/rkKFkDZiOZOYgRT4K5agGB25QWU4aNcqdTzPiRyzElkmE1flbIxd+mPTZY/2P86KpETxkkhmvpK73a3CWde90nbl2wd6szCDjqcv6uZMV6HyDQI3LveGwVt6mLJg==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=intel.com; dmarc=pass action=none header.from=intel.com; dkim=pass header.d=intel.com; arc=none Received: from DM5PR11MB1690.namprd11.prod.outlook.com (2603:10b6:3:15::11) by DM6PR11MB2665.namprd11.prod.outlook.com (2603:10b6:5:c3::12)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.3088.18; Mon, 15 Jun 2020 08:54:47 +0000 Received: from DM5PR11MB1690.namprd11.prod.outlook.com ([fe80::811c:6750:dda0:3fbb]) by DM5PR11MB1690.namprd11.prod.outlook.com ([fe80::811c:6750:dda0:3fbb%3]) with mapi id 15.20.3088.028; Mon, 15 Jun 2020 08:54:47 +0000 From: "Metzger, Markus T" To: Simon Marchi , Shahab Vahedi , Luis Machado CC: "gdb@sourceware.org" , Shahab Vahedi Subject: RE: Why enforcing sw_breakpoint_from_kind() implementation in GDBserver targets Thread-Topic: Why enforcing sw_breakpoint_from_kind() implementation in GDBserver targets Thread-Index: AQHWP081zsvL5rTUSE69sjOzhIpA8qjSu74AgABuaQCAAA9MgIAABxSAgABAUACABeDXcA== Date: Mon, 15 Jun 2020 08:54:47 +0000 Message-ID: References: <20200610174702.GA3486@gmail.com> <8f80e486-cca4-819b-7316-329832df985f@simark.ca> <20200611094048.GA1270@gmail.com> <07362b1e-3b9b-a858-ce7a-9a27daff511a@linaro.org> <20200611110053.GD1270@gmail.com> <335e5978-4893-b355-69cd-98a101f8dd2e@simark.ca> In-Reply-To: <335e5978-4893-b355-69cd-98a101f8dd2e@simark.ca>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: dlp-reaction: no-action dlp-version: 11.2.0.6 dlp-product: dlpe-windows x-originating-ip: [134.191.221.117] x-ms-publictraffictype: Email x-ms-office365-filtering-correlation-id: 59607f22-871d-49ba-fa8b-08d81109c185 x-ms-traffictypediagnostic: DM6PR11MB2665: x-ms-exchange-transport-forked: True x-microsoft-antispam-prvs: x-ms-oob-tlc-oobclassifiers: OLM:10000; x-forefront-prvs: 04359FAD81 x-ms-exchange-senderadcheck: 1 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: AeFvVJ93FMeVmVI4D4TMhSD/RXyV3o7JZxQW6hudL4cgyaCjReBjPrkzPymg5vNKx8wjlONPqxarXULsouasMgfj/ngS7G1lBhIIs1/k4w4mQIIR/yRy4tWGQjjuwZSHN3pICYz9npHqsxqVcBO1/qKxd8wwjIGijlKmmpHeYiKl4kT0pIHnyILQChho2yCTpvF3/gEcpXTGpJHcRBv563o8Gnr/PXDPthnKW4ylDu49d5zuVFfEX9i7748D6lrc5X8uuB6DdBR+HK4q72oWdXDl60UFwqovu96wybG/A4ebiPwVfz559tNJCDuqRmGicmpDxN0BgAyvQA+JmOTpUg== x-forefront-antispam-report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:DM5PR11MB1690.namprd11.prod.outlook.com; PTR:; CAT:NONE; SFTY:; SFS:(346002)(39860400002)(366004)(376002)(136003)(396003)(86362001)(64756008)(66446008)(66556008)(76116006)(54906003)(110136005)(66946007)(66476007)(316002)(71200400001)(2906002)(26005)(4326008)(8936002)(9686003)(52536014)(6506007)(55016002)(478600001)(8676002)(5660300002)(186003)(7696005)(33656002); DIR:OUT; SFP:1102; x-ms-exchange-antispam-messagedata: EKTCOqQLCQIfBn7/4kTRmQvrLc598cBGh7UamYqUR64fJ/Ui+YQiEcYpzN7aPIavlUuoO4lQV+BrWaVXZrIZM6kd4scTapV/7opg41pjGoSt94zX0UYb2sGVy94DtkCLZSLAp0T3Q2VbjrvGVO3qJjNmcr5kWv65N04301Hht9DBT3WAkNHeX77QqLixy06WdvitPAwcZ/WzTTdAxda/P62siA/qduf5TLxwOot0OPIMC85AmmzQtENsoThLU2BXifcQRB9WoLVJexOrJUyEgDbKFJY4f41R0B7+OIP5SV849fSdfQRPdCT43zUdAxP2gZ7dRYi8mFAsLZYCHvU44MwtnNoRVgXVbsbTO/96MwU8UP5ykVdcYWxIhx6PLzWBMSq2lvsGjwuzXf96VgLrVMcEFuaPTG9eZbuza93gqIPTrL27eeO2bzScJ/Gv2IjS2cPzBDLCoMa5Hqrdg5SW1eqjGOCd6Dh+TbMOyD7+qwLZy6Zov6zIogtvXzmt/5FX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 X-MS-Exchange-CrossTenant-Network-Message-Id: 59607f22-871d-49ba-fa8b-08d81109c185 X-MS-Exchange-CrossTenant-originalarrivaltime: 15 Jun 2020 08:54:47.0906 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: XwKs+Mt0WUA0hB52JgOE11fQGRawabwfca7SRBUNysOfC3q0OH24Kp2k2kfJQG9RfPCX6hPE9FsZP1j41UNJVgrKcQpR84QqtC3hj/+e5cM= X-MS-Exchange-Transport-CrossTenantHeadersStamped: DM6PR11MB2665 X-OriginatorOrg: intel.com Content-Transfer-Encoding: base64 X-Spam-Status: No, score=-3.2 required=5.0 tests=BAYES_00, DKIM_INVALID, DKIM_SIGNED, KAM_DMARC_STATUS, SPF_HELO_PASS, SPF_PASS, TXREP autolearn=no autolearn_force=no version=3.4.2 X-Spam-Checker-Version: SpamAssassin 3.4.2 (2018-09-13) on server2.sourceware.org X-BeenThere: gdb@sourceware.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Gdb mailing list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 15 Jun 2020 08:54:53 -0000 PiA+Pj4gVGhlIEFSQyBHREIgY2xpZW50IGluc2VydHMgdGhlIGJyZWFrcG9pbnQgYnkgd3JpdGlu ZyB0byBtZW1vcnkgKHRoZQ0KPiA+Pj4gbGVnYWN5IHdheSkuIFdpdGggeW91ciBleHBsYW5hdGlv bnMsIEkgcGxhbiB0byBhZGQgdGhlIFowIHBhY2tldA0KPiA+Pj4gc3VwcG9ydCB0byBpdC4gIE5l dmVydGhlbGVzcywgc2hvdWxkIGl0IGJlIHN0aWxsIG5lY2Vzc2FyeSB0byBoYXZlDQo+ID4+PiAi c3dfYnJlYWtwb2ludF9mcm9tX2tpbmQiIGluIEdEQnNlcnZlciBhcyBhIG1hbmRhdG9yeSBtZXRo b2Q/DQo+ID4NCj4gPiBTaW1vbiwgSSB0aG91Z2h0IGFib3V0IHRoaXMgYSBsaXR0bGUuIEFyZSB3 ZSBhaW1pbmcgZm9yIGRlcHJlY2F0aW5nDQo+ID4gdGhlIG9sZCB3YXk/IFRoZW4gSSBndWVzcyB0 aGF0J3MgdGhlIHdheSB0byBnby4NCj4gDQo+IElmIGFsbCB0aGUgZ2Ric2VydmVyIHRhcmdldHMg d2Ugc3VwcG9ydCBkbyBzdXBwb3J0IFowLCB0aGVuIHllcyBJIHRoaW5rDQo+IHdlIGNvdWxkIGNv bnNpZGVyIGRvaW5nIHRoYXQuICBIb3cgd291bGQgd2UgZG8gaXQ/ICBNYWtlIGluc2VydF9wb2lu dA0KPiBhbmQgcmVtb3ZlX3BvaW50IHZpcnR1YWwgcHVyZSB0byBmb3JjZSBzdWItY2xhc3NlcyB0 byBpbXBsZW1lbnQgdGhlbQ0KPiB3aXRoIHNvbWV0aGluZyBtZWFuaW5nZnVsPw0KPiANCj4gTm90 ZSB0aGF0IHRoaXMgd291bGQgb25seSBjb25jZXJuIEdEQnNlcnZlciwgb3RoZXIgc2VydmVyIGlt cGxlbWVudGF0aW9ucw0KPiBvZiB0aGUgcmVtb3RlIHByb3RvY29sIGFyZSBmcmVlIHRvIHN1cHBv cnQgWjAgb3Igbm90LiAgQnV0IHdlIGNvdWxkIGRlY2lkZQ0KPiB0aGF0IGFsbCBHREJzZXJ2ZXIg cG9ydHMgaGF2ZSB0byBzdXBwb3J0IGl0Lg0KDQpUaGUgSW50ZWwgR3JhcGhpY3MgYXJjaGl0ZWN0 dXJlIHVzZXMgYnJlYWtwb2ludCBiaXRzIGluc2lkZSBpbnN0cnVjdGlvbnMuICBUaGVyZQ0KaXMg bm8gc2luZ2xlIGJyZWFrcG9pbnQgb3Bjb2RlIGFzIHRoZXJlIGlzIElOVDMgb24gSUEsIGZvciBl eGFtcGxlLg0KDQpUaGUgYnJlYWtwb2ludCBjYW4gYmUgaWdub3JlZCBvbmUgdGltZSwgd2hpY2gg YWxsb3dzIHN0ZXBwaW5nIG92ZXIgYnJlYWtwb2ludHMNCndpdGhvdXQgaGF2aW5nIHRvICByZW1v dmUgdGhlbS4gIFRoaXMgb2J2aW91c2x5IG9ubHkgd29ya3MgaWYgdGhlIGJyZWFrcG9pbnQgYml0 DQppbiB0aGUgb3JpZ2luYWwgaW5zdHJ1Y3Rpb24gaXMgc2V0IGFuZCB0aGUgaW5zdHJ1Y3Rpb24g aXMgbm90IHJlcGxhY2VkIHdpdGggYSBmaXhlZA0KYnJlYWtwb2ludCBwYXR0ZXJuLg0KDQpJJ3Zl IGJlZW4gbG9va2luZyBpbnRvIHogcGFja2V0cyBhbmQgaW5zZXJ0L3JlbW92ZV9wb2ludCAoKSB0 YXJnZXQgbWV0aG9kcy4NClNpbmNlIHN0cnVjdCByYXdfYnJlYWtwb2ludCBpcyBvcGFxdWUsIGl0 IHdvdWxkIG5vdCBhbGxvdyBtZSB0byBzdG9yZSBhIHNoYWRvdw0KY29weSAtIHVubGVzcyBJIGV4 dGVuZGVkIG1lbS1icmVhay5jYyB0byBkbyB0aGF0IGZvciBtZS4NCg0KSSBlbmRlZCB1cCB1c2lu ZyB0aGUgZ2RiYXJjaCBtZXRob2RzLg0KDQpSZWdhcmRzLA0KTWFya3VzLg0KDQpJbnRlbCBEZXV0 c2NobGFuZCBHbWJIClJlZ2lzdGVyZWQgQWRkcmVzczogQW0gQ2FtcGVvbiAxMC0xMiwgODU1Nzkg TmV1YmliZXJnLCBHZXJtYW55ClRlbDogKzQ5IDg5IDk5IDg4NTMtMCwgd3d3LmludGVsLmRlCk1h bmFnaW5nIERpcmVjdG9yczogQ2hyaXN0aW4gRWlzZW5zY2htaWQsIEdhcnkgS2Vyc2hhdwpDaGFp cnBlcnNvbiBvZiB0aGUgU3VwZXJ2aXNvcnkgQm9hcmQ6IE5pY29sZSBMYXUKUmVnaXN0ZXJlZCBP ZmZpY2U6IE11bmljaApDb21tZXJjaWFsIFJlZ2lzdGVyOiBBbXRzZ2VyaWNodCBNdWVuY2hlbiBI UkIgMTg2OTI4Cg==